Dyson states that manufacturer parts or service have ended for DC16 (DC16). Do not present a generic Dyson parts link as verified fit; any third-party or donor part requires independent compatibility and safety checks.

- Power the handheld off, disconnect its charger, and remove a detachable battery only when the exact owner guide describes that action.
- Use only owner-access points and maintenance actions documented for the exact machine code.
- Do not use or charge a swollen, leaking, cracked, wet, punctured, unusually hot, or impact-damaged battery.
- Replace the complete genuine battery assembly only. Never open the pack or replace individual cells.

Confirm that the battery is the likely fault
Record runtime and charging indicators, confirm the matching charger and outlet work, clean dry external contacts, and let the battery reach normal room temperature. A no-power symptom can also come from the charger, controls, airflow protection, or main body.
Match the replacement to the machine code
Order a complete battery pack specified for the exact machine code listed for DC16 (DC16). Legacy battery/charger platform for which Dyson has ended manufacturer parts and service. Do not choose by retail family name or physical appearance alone.
Remove the old complete battery
Power the machine off, disconnect the charger, press the documented battery release, and withdraw the complete click-in or swappable pack without forcing it.
Install, charge, and test
Seat the exact replacement using the reverse documented method, confirm every latch or owner battery-cover screw is secure, and charge it with the matching charger. Make one normal test and stop for heat, odor, swelling, an error, or continued short runtime.
